Kuwait to Discuss Dual Citizenship Cases with Other Countries

The Kuwaiti government has said it will meet with other countries to discuss the issue of dual citizenship for Kuwaiti citizens, after discovering several new cases of dual citizenship among its nationals. This move is a clear indication of Kuwait’s strong position on the matter, as dual citizenship is strictly prohibited under Kuwaiti law.

The authorities have increased surveillance of those who secretly hold a second passport, and official reports have indicated that some Kuwaitis have obtained the nationalities of foreign nations while retaining their own. The government is now working to coordinate with other countries to verify and address these cases.

Officialdom officials have warned that those found guilty of concealing a second nationality could face possible legal repercussions and also the revocation of their Kuwaiti citizenship. The government has also called on citizens to comply with the nationality laws and cautioned against fraudulent practices to bypass regulations.

This latest measure is in line with Kuwait’s overall national security and identity protection policies, which are intended to ensure openness and maintain the country’s stringent nationality laws. The issue of dual citizenship has always been a sensitive one in Kuwait, leading to more aggressive enforcement in recent years.
